Top 5 games
#1. The Elder Scrolls V SKYRIM
- Publisher: Bethesda Softworks
- Developer: Bethesda Game Studios
- Engine: Creation Engine with Havoc Physics
- Platforms: Microsoft Windows, PlayStation 3, Xbox 360
#2. Mount & Blade WARBAND
- Publisher: Paradox Interactive
- Developer: TaleWorlds Entertainment
- Engine: Dazubo/Mount&Blade
- Platforms: Microsoft Windows
#3. Dont Starve Together
- Publisher: Klei Entertainment
- Developer: Klei Entertainment
- Engine: Unity
- Platforms: Microsoft Windows
#4. CS GO
- Publisher: Valve Corporation
- Developer: Valve Corporation, Hidden Path Entertainment
- Engine: Source Engine
- Platforms: Microsoft Windows, PlayStation 3, Xbox 360, OS X, GNU/Linux, Mac OS
#5. Besiege
- Publisher: Spiderling Studios
- Developer: Spiderling Studios
- Engine: Unity
- Platforms: Microsoft Windows, Linux, Mac
